Important Things to Know when Writing Letter For Ii Application

Clear Purpose And Intent

A letter template for an II application should communicate a clear purpose and intent to engage the reader effectively. Start by outlining your objectives and the specific reasons for your application, ensuring each section is concise and focused. Use language that reflects your enthusiasm and alignment with the values of the institution or program you are addressing. Crafting your message thoughtfully will help convey your commitment and enhance the impact of your application.

Proper Format And Structure

A well-organized letter template for an II application should include a clear introduction, body, and conclusion. Start with your contact information and the recipient's details, followed by a formal greeting. In the body, provide relevant information about your qualifications, experiences, and why you are a suitable candidate for the position. Ensure you conclude with a polite closing statement and your signature, maintaining a professional tone throughout the document.

Concise And Professional Language

Using concise and professional language in your letter template for an II application is crucial for making a favorable impression. Clear and straightforward wording helps to convey your intentions and qualifications effectively, ensuring that the reviewer can quickly understand your key points. Aim to limit jargon and unnecessary details, allowing your core message to shine through. Ensuring that each sentence serves a purpose will enhance the overall readability and professionalism of your letter.

Relevant Supporting Details

When preparing a letter template for an II application, it is crucial to include relevant supporting details that align with your qualifications and experiences. This may entail highlighting specific skills, achievements, or projects that showcase your expertise in the field. Be sure to tailor these details to the requirements outlined in the application, enhancing your overall appeal. Your ability to effectively communicate how your background makes you a suitable candidate can significantly impact the success of your application.

Contact Information And Signature

When creating a letter template for an II application, always include accurate contact information at the top, ensuring that your name, address, email, and phone number are clearly visible. This allows the recipient to easily reach you for any follow-up or queries. A professional signature at the end of the letter is equally crucial, as it adds a personal touch and validates the authenticity of your application. Make sure your signature is neatly formatted, preferably scanned, to maintain a polished appearance.
